November signals the start of the festive season for many of us. Even if Christmas feels a bit distant, the key is to nurture a warm, loving mood of anticipation. Pre-Christmas decorating lets you gently bring the holiday spirit into your home early, without overwhelming the space with full-on Christmas fever.

In this guide, we’re sharing five decor tips that subtly hint at Christmas cheer while preserving November’s unique charm. Let’s explore how to make your home feel extra cozy this season!

Creating a Warm Atmosphere

Candles are one of the easiest and most striking ways to add warmth to your home. Aim for a balanced arrangement that complements the rest of your space.

Choose golden yellows, reds, or even greens—colors that bring Christmas vibes without going overboard. Don’t forget tealights and string lights, which create unforgettable cozy moments on long, dark November evenings.

Natural Elements

Bringing nature indoors is always a great idea for fresh yet festive vibes. Pine branches, cones, or dried orange slices fit perfectly with pre-Christmas decor trends.

Decorate your table with pine sprigs or hang small wreaths on your front door for an impressive touch. These natural elements not only look beautiful but also fill your home with inviting scents.

The Role of Textiles in Holiday Prep

Adding soft, warm textiles instantly makes any room feel cozier. Think chunky knit blankets draped over the sofa, ready for chilly nights.

Pick decorative pillows in festive reds or greens to directly evoke the holiday spirit. Swap out tablecloths, runners, and rugs for darker tones to align your space with the season.

A Little DIY Fun

Make your home truly unique with DIY decorations that add a personal touch.

Create your own advent calendar to hang up in November, or try crafting wreaths decorated with letters and leaves—these can even become a cozy centerpiece in your living room.

The Power of Natural Spices

Choosing the right scents is key to setting your home’s mood. Use cinnamon, orange, vanilla, or cloves to match your decor’s vibe. You can make potpourri or garlands with these spices.

Scented candles and spice-filled bowls bring Christmas cheer without being overpowering. When scents harmonize, they delight not just the eyes but all your senses.
